About Kuo-Kuang Bus 1819 (Taoyuan Airport - Taipei Transfer Station) Round Trip
Hop on the Kuo-Kuang Bus 1819 for a seamless 24-hour shuttle between Taoyuan International Airport and Taipei's central transfer station. With affordable round-trip pricing, free Wi-Fi, USB charging ports, and even a complimentary shuttle to Ximending with your ticket stub, this budget-friendly ride is the smartest way to start or end your Taiwan adventure.
Local Legends & Stories
Kuo-Kuang Bus has been a trusted name in Taiwan's intercity and airport shuttle network for decades, known for reliability and affordability. The 1819 route has become a favorite among backpackers and budget travelers who appreciate its no-nonsense service and consistent comfort.

Cultural Etiquette
Respect local customs and traditions
Taiwanese bus culture values courtesy and order — passengers typically wait for others to exit before boarding. It's customary to keep voices low and offer your seat to elderly passengers or those with young children. Tipping is not expected on public and intercity buses in Taiwan.

Visitor Information
Entry Fee
Round-trip tickets are significantly cheaper than purchasing two one-way tickets at the counter. Prices start at approximately TWD 230-280 for a round trip, making it one of the most budget-friendly airport transfer options in Taipei.
Visit Duration
The one-way journey takes approximately 40-50 minutes depending on traffic conditions. Plan for a round-trip experience of about 1.5 to 2 hours total, including boarding and any waiting time between departures.
Accessibility
Kuo-Kuang Bus 1819 is wheelchair accessible with designated seating areas and ramp boarding. Assistance is available upon request — simply inform the driver or staff when boarding.

- No re-issuing of tickets, please store with care.
- Tickets are not seat allocated, seats cannot be booked in advance.
- Return ticket expires 6 months after day of redemption.
- Riding time and bus scheduling may be subjected to weather or on-road delays.
- Luggage measurements shouldn’t exceed 180cm for the total from length, width and height. The luggage compartment on the coach is limited.
- Children under 2 can hop on free-of-charge, 3-11 year old kids can purchase half-priced tickets on site, 12 year old and above will be deemed as adults.
- 2 luggage per person, for every extra luggage, a half-priced ticket surcharge will be issued, please pay onboard.
